Course Details
• Introduction to Textile Upcycling: Understanding the basics of textile upcycling, its importance, and benefits in a circular economy.
• Sustainable Textile Sourcing: Identifying and sourcing sustainable textiles for upcycling projects.
• Textile Upcycling Techniques: Exploring various upcycling techniques, such as deconstruction, reconstruction, and redesign.
• Designing for Textile Upcycling: Learning how to create designs that incorporate upcycled textiles.
• Pattern Making and Construction: Mastering the art of pattern making and construction for upcycled garments.
• Ethical and Social Considerations: Understanding the ethical and social implications of textile upcycling.
• Textile Upcycling Case Studies: Analyzing real-world examples of successful textile upcycling projects.
• Marketing and Selling Upcycled Products: Developing strategies for marketing and selling upcycled textile products.
• Measurement and Evaluation: Evaluating the impact and success of textile upcycling projects.
